1946

Astron Project Inception

Nicholas Christofilos applies for an accelerator patent, and the Astron project begins at Livermore National Laboratory focusing on relativistic electron rings.

1949

Christofilos conceives strong-focusing principle for accelerators

Patented 1950. Rediscovered by Brookhaven 1952. Revolutionized accelerators. Weapons application proposed by Wilson.

1952

Project Sherwood established

The U.S. AEC's classified controlled-fusion program begins at LANL and partner labs.

historical-context
1952

Livermore Laboratory Established

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ory is created at the urging of Edward Teller and Ernest Lawrence to pursue the hydrogen bomb.

1956

Christofilos begins Astron experiment at LLNL

Greek engineer starts E-layer field reversal concept. Earliest compact torus conception. Presented at 1958 Geneva.

historical-context
1956

Astron Program at LLNL

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ory operates the Astron program to achieve stable field reversal using linear induction accelerators.
